About the role
The Operating Unit (OU) Data Lead plays a pivotal role in activating Haleon’s Data and AI strategy locally and ensuring that Data & AI services drive measurable business value in Operating Units, as the business-facing data leader for China.
Operating as the primary interface between the Data Office and OU, the role translates business priorities into actionable data demand, ensures high-quality delivery of data and intelligence products, and drives alignment of enterprise-wide ways of working across intelligence, analytics, and data governance in OUs.
The role is part of the Data Office team and reports to the Head of OU Data.
The job holder will be based in China, to ensure proximity to key Operating Unit stakeholders.
Key responsibilities
Business Engagement and Demand Leadership:
Act as the single point of accountability for data & AI within the Operating Unit.
Partner closely with OU business leaders to identify, shape and prioritise use cases, business questions and opportunities.
Translate complex business needs into clear data & AI requirements, ensuring alignment to enterprise standards and services.
Activation of Haleon’s Data & AI Strategy:
Drive awareness of Haleon’s enterprise-wide Data & AI strategy in the OU.
Ensure consistent application of Data & AI services and standards within the OU.
Serve as a trusted advisor to senior stakeholders on how data & AI can drive growth, efficiency, and better decision-making
Cross-Functional Leadership & Ways of Working:
Lead and coordinate OU‑aligned data roles, ensuring consistent application of data & AI services in the OU.
Work seamlessly with global Data Office roles (e.g. Data Engineering, Data Science, AI, Enterprise Data Management) to deliver quality outcomes at pace.
Drive consistent governance, prioritisation and delivery discipline, including strong project‑level governance.
Value Realisation and Delivery:
Own the end‑to‑end data lifecycle from demand to delivered intelligence in the OU, ensuring outputs are actionable, adopted and drive value.
Support definition of success measures, benefits hypotheses and value tracking for OU data and AI initiatives.
Act as a sounding board for data & AI demand, validating assumptions and ensuring enterprise relevance.
Innovation & Continuous Improvement:
Feed OU insights, learnings and needs into the enterprise innovation and value pipeline.
Advise on emerging digital, data and analytics trends relevant to the Operating Unit.
Ensure application of data & AI services follow industry best practice and Haleon standards.
